The city of Hartford, Connecticut has no less than five dozen multimedia production companies and many local artists pursuing careers in multimedia design.  Audio-visual editing is the most available occupation in the field of visual arts, and Hartford is hopping with opportunities for artists pursuing careers in this creative, high tech field.

Hartford Schools and Training Programs for Multimedia Editing

Colleges, Universities and film schools in and around Hartford, Connecticut feature all the courses needed for professional work in the field of audio-visual editing design.  Hartford area art colleges with multimedia departments include Capital Community College in Hartford, Manchester Community College in Manchester, Naugatuck Valley Community College in Waterbury, Northwestern Connecticut Community College in Winstead and Wesleyan University in Middletown, among others.  Aspiring Hartford media editors typically major in mass media or communications design.

Some Hartford art students earn skills and degrees via virtual educational programs.  Popular accredited online film schools include the Academy of Art University, Full Sail University, Stratford Career Institute, University of Phoenix, The Art Institutes, ITT Tech and DeVry.  Some internet-based film schools provide supplemental local campuses.  University of Phoenix has a campus in Fairfield.

Working as a Multimedia Editor in Hartford, Connecticut

Hoards of commercial businesses in Hartford, Connecticut hire professional audio-visual editors for various multimedia projects.  Some local media editors sign up with Hartford TV stations like Connecticut-Public-Broadcasting, Hartford-Public-Access, New-England-Cable-News, Tribune-Broadcasting and WTNH-Channel-8.  Hartford sound editors are sometimes employed by local radio stations like Cameo-Broadcasting, Freedom-Communications, Marlin-Broadcasting, Tiberius-Broadcasting and WWYZ-Fm.

Multimedia professionals employed full time in Hartford, Connecticut earn, on average, about $63,000 per year, according to data compiled by the Bureau of Labor Statistics.  Connecticut ranks fourth among states in terms of average annual income for multimedia artists in general  However, this data does not reflect the incomes of part time editors or local freelance professionals.  

Skills of a Professional Multimedia Editor

The most basic technical skills involved in professional multimedia editing design are familiarity with computer operating systems and all related editing design software.  Among the most popular editing software packages are After Effects, Final Cut and Unreal Editor.  Audio-visual editors are also handy with other multimedia design-related software programs like Adobe Premier, Adobe Illustrator, Photo Shop, Power Point and others.  Multimedia editing calls for someone with highly developed interpersonal skills in order to maintain smooth collaboration with other creative professionals.  They also need exceptional communication skills to consistently follow directions.  Lastly, multimedia editors are detail-oriented perfectionists down to the smallest detail.
